Best time to go to Penticton

The best time to visit Penticton is dependant on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is sunny with no rain. December is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January25.0°F (-3.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February25.9°F (-3.4°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ageAverage
March34.2°F (1.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April42.8°F (6.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
May54.5°F (12.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June60.4°F (15.8°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ly SunnyModerately HighSlightly High
July68.5°F (20.3°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nyModerately HighSlightly High
August68.2°F (20.1°C)No Rain (Dry)SunnyModerately HighSlightly High
September58.3°F (14.6°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ly SunnyAverageAverage
October45.0°F (7.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owAverage
November32.0°F (0.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December23.5°F (-4.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low

The nearest major airports for your trip to Penticton

Penticton, British Columbia, is easily accessible via two major airports. Kelowna International Airport (YLW) is situated 33 miles away, with nearby hotel options such as the 4-star Delta Hotels by Marriott Grand Okanagan Resort and The Royal Kelowna, both 7 miles from the airport, and the charming A Vista Villa Couples Retreat, located 5 miles away. Alternatively, Penticton Regional Airport (YYF) is only 3 miles from the city, offering convenient access to accommodations like the 4-star Munson Mountain Estates and OK Whistle Stop Bed & Breakfast, along with the 3.5-star Penticton Lakeside Resort and Conference Centre, which is just 3 miles from the airport.

When is the best time to go to Penticton?
The most popular time to visit Penticton is in July. During this peak season, which spans from June to August, temperatures typically soar into the mid-80s Fahrenheit, creating an inclusive setting for outdoor adventures and leisurely sightseeing. This pleasant weather is great for exploring the stunning lakes, vineyards, and parks that define the region, making it an excellent choice for active travelers looking to enjoy the natural beauty and vibrant culture of the area.

In July, Penticton buzzes with activity, thanks to various festivals and events that showcase local food, art, and music. The warm days are ideal for water activities on Okanagan Lake, such as paddleboarding and swimming, while the evenings often feature outdoor concerts and markets. If you appreciate attentive service, many local businesses offer guided tours and personalized experiences that can help you make the most of your visit.

For those who prefer a quieter experience, consider visiting in September. This month still offers delightful weather, with temperatures comfortably in the low 70s Fahrenheit, and a more relaxed atmosphere as families return home for the school year. You can enjoy the breathtaking fall colors in the vineyards and take advantage of the harvest season, which means plenty of opportunities for wine tastings and culinary experiences at local restaurants.
